Mount Baseball Team Volunteers at Thanksgiving Dinner
Baseball Thanksgiving
Bookmark and Share
NEWBURGH, N.Y. – Members of the Mount Saint Mary College baseball team volunteered their time to serve Thanksgiving dinner at a local church on Wednesday, November 25. The effort was part of the broader Blue Knights in the Community project taken on by the athletic department as a whole.

Plastic aprons covered the Mount Saint Mary College sweatshirts as the Blue Knights served Thanksgiving meals to the families at the Ebenezer Baptist Church in Newburgh. Four local players teamed with head coach Steve Sosler (Florida, N.Y.) at the event.

Pictured in the photo, from left to right, are: Coach Sosler, freshman Paul Cherubino (Pine Bush, N.Y.), sophomore John Conroy (Middletown, N.Y.), senior Brian O’Connor (Campbell Hall, N.Y.), and senior Frank Snyder (Wallkill, N.Y.).

Athletes of the Week
Matt Prescia
Baseball
Freshman Matt Prescia batted .412 with six runs scored and five runs batted in during the Skyline Conference tournament.  In an extra-inning game against St. Joseph's College, Prescia's two-run single in the top of the eleventh proved to be the difference as the Knights advanced with a 7-5 victory.  The freshman finished with seven hits in the tournament, including at least one in each game.
Christine DelPiano
Softball
Senior Christine DelPiano batted .400 and slugged 1.000 during the Skyline Conference tournament.  During a 7-6 victory over Old Westbury in a loser's bracket game, DelPiano was 2-for-4 with a pair of two-run homers.  Her two-out, seventh inning blast saved the Knights from elimination.  DelPiano recorded at least one hit in all three games.
